A … WebMar 1, 2024 · First connect red cable to the positive terminal of your Fiat 500’s dead battery, then to the positive terminal of donor battery. Next connect black cable to the negative terminal of donor battery, then to the bare metal in the engine bay of your Fiat 500. Start the donor vehicle and then your Fiat 500. Remove the cables in reverse order.

Dead battery: Cold temperatures can reduce a battery’s power output, making it harder to start the engine. Hardened oil: Cold temperatures can make the oil in your car thicker, making it harder for the engine to turn over.
